So, what’s the main goal of a massage when you’re pampering yourself in a salon? The correct answer—and a pretty compelling one at that—is to improve blood circulation and relaxation. Picture this: when a trained therapist works their magic on your muscles, the increased blood flow helps deliver oxygen and nutrients right to where your skin and tissues need it most. Talk about a beauty boost!

But wait, there’s more. Improved circulation is like giving your skin a refreshing drink of water. It helps flush out metabolic waste, making way for healthier, more vibrant skin. That’s something we can all get on board with. And who doesn’t want to leave the salon feeling rejuvenated and glowing?

And let’s talk about beauty for a second. While some folks might think massages are just about coziness, they also serve another purpose: enhancing product absorption. When your skin is warm and your circulation is flowing, how much more ready is it to soak up those nourishing lotions and serums? In other words, that fancy moisturizer you just splurged on might just work a little harder for you post-massage. It's like giving your skincare a VIP pass.
